I truly enjoy looking at charts using elliott wave analysis as I have been doing it for over a decade with stocks and options. Many might think I'm crazy to apply it here with $pepe, NFTs and other coins.
EW is based on social mood and market sentiment with a set of fundamental rules on wave structure. I believe social mood is still very pure in NFT and crypto with pure greed balanced with pure fear. FUD vs. FOMO. Human behavior as a whole is what drives prices up or down and I feel its so raw in this market which makes EW charting fun!

Testing periods are an important time for traders and investors to watch closely, as it can provide valuable information about the strength of the accumulation pattern.
During these times we focus on:
(1) Price Action; During the testing period, the price of the asset should remain within a relatively narrow range. If the price starts to move outside of this range, it could indicate that the accumulation pattern is not as strong as originally thought.
(2) Volume; an important factor to watch during the testing periods. Ideally, volume should be low during this time, as it suggests that the market is consolidating before making a move higher. If volume starts to pick up, it could indicate that sellers are starting to take control of the market.
(3) Support and resistance; If the price repeatedly tests a support level and holds during the testing period, it could indicate that buyers are still in control of the market. Conversely, if the price repeatedly tests a resistance level and fails to break through, it could indicate that sellers are gaining the upper hand.
